4000 square feet, suitable for the use of 1 team or individual rental, or a group for an evening. Enough room to stretch out and play cards, etc.
1 Hitting Tunnel,separate pitcher's mound,Full Basketball Court, Agility and Limited Strength Training Equipment including a Multech Heavybag
Hack Attack Jr. pitching machine available and included in the cost.
The Hack Attack Jr. is the most realistic pitching machine on the market. Its a 3 wheeled machine that is very accurate and shows the batter the ball throughout delivery. All pitches can be thrown.
